What Are the Characteristics of the Best Quality Full Size Mattress?
The best quality full size mattress features durability, comfort, support, and materials that enhance sleep quality.
- Comfort Level
- Support and Firmness
- Material Quality
- Durability
- Motion Isolation
- Temperature Regulation
- Hypoallergenic Properties
Understanding these characteristics can help individuals make informed decisions when selecting a mattress, as preferences may vary among consumers.
-
Comfort Level:
The comfort level of a full size mattress directly influences sleep quality. Comfort is often achieved through various layers that provide a plush or softer feel. Many experts recommend considering personal preferences for mattress firmness, which can range from soft to firm. According to a 2018 study by the National Sleep Foundation, individuals who rate their mattress comfort as higher tend to report improved sleep satisfaction. -
Support and Firmness:
Support and firmness are essential for spinal alignment. A mattress should maintain the natural curve of the spine while providing adequate support. A medium-firm mattress often balances support and comfort, accommodating various sleeping positions. The American Chiropractic Association highlights the importance of a supportive mattress in preventing back pain and promoting healthy sleep. -
Material Quality:
Material quality defines the overall longevity and performance of a mattress. Full size mattresses are commonly made from foam, innerspring, or hybrid materials. High-quality foam, such as memory foam, contours to the body, providing effective pressure relief. In contrast, innerspring mattresses offer bounce and support through coils. The superior durability of natural latex mattresses is also recognized, offering a longer lifespan compared to synthetic options. -
Durability:
Durability impacts how long a mattress remains comfortable and supportive. The best quality full size mattresses are constructed with high-grade materials that resist sagging and wear. The industry-standard lifespan of a mattress is about 7 to 10 years, but top-tier models can last longer with proper maintenance. Studies indicate that a durable mattress contributes to sustained sleep quality over time, positively affecting overall health. -
Motion Isolation:
Motion isolation is crucial for couples or individuals who share a bed. A mattress that effectively dampens motion prevents disturbances when a partner moves during the night. Memory foam mattresses are known for their exceptional motion isolation properties. A 2021 report by Sleepopolis emphasizes that better motion isolation can lead to a more restful sleep experience for both individuals. -
Temperature Regulation:
Temperature regulation helps maintain an ideal sleep environment. Full size mattresses with cooling technologies, such as gel-infused foam or breathable covers, prevent overheating. Consumers often report better sleep quality with mattresses designed to dissipate body heat. The Journal of Clinical Sleep Medicine has cited temperature control as a vital factor in sleep efficiency and comfort. -
Hypoallergenic Properties:
Hypoallergenic properties are essential for those with allergies or sensitivities. Mattresses made from natural materials, like organic cotton or latex, tend to resist dust mites and mold. The Asthma and Allergy Foundation of America recommends hypoallergenic mattresses as a preferable option for allergy sufferers. Choosing a full size mattress with these properties can significantly enhance sleeping conditions and overall health.

How Does Memory Foam Improve Sleep Satisfaction in Full Size Mattresses?
Memory foam improves sleep satisfaction in full-size mattresses through several key mechanisms. First, memory foam conforms to the body’s shape. This feature allows the mattress to relieve pressure points effectively. Second, it provides excellent support. The material adapts to each sleeper’s specific body contours, promoting proper spinal alignment. Third, memory foam minimizes motion transfer. This characteristic is beneficial for couples or users who move frequently during sleep.
Moreover, memory foam generally has a slow recovery time. It molds to the body and slowly returns to its original shape, which creates a cushioning effect. This responsiveness enhances comfort throughout the night. Additionally, many memory foam mattresses feature cooling technologies. These technologies help regulate temperature, preventing overheating during sleep.
Finally, the combination of support, pressure relief, and temperature control significantly contributes to improved sleep quality and satisfaction. Sleepers often report waking up less frequently and feeling more rested. This overall enhancement of the sleep experience is why memory foam is popular for full-size mattresses.
Why Are Organic Materials Important in Full Size Mattress Construction?
Organic materials are important in full-size mattress construction because they enhance comfort, provide better breathability, and reduce harmful emissions. These materials, such as organic cotton, natural latex, and wool, are derived from renewable resources. They contribute to a healthier sleeping environment compared to synthetic alternatives.
According to the Global Organic Textile Standards (GOTS), organic textiles are made from fibers grown without the use of harmful chemicals and pesticides. This means that organic mattresses are eco-friendly and safer for human health.
The significance of organic materials stems from their physical properties and health benefits. Organic cotton offers softness and moisture-wicking abilities, which help regulate temperature. Natural latex is durable and provides support while minimizing allergens. Wool has inherent fire-resistant properties and naturally regulates moisture.
When discussing technical terms, “natural latex” refers to a latex derived from the sap of rubber trees. This material is biodegradable and free from synthetic additives. “Moisture-wicking” describes a material’s ability to draw moisture away from the body, enhancing comfort during sleep.
The mechanisms by which organic materials improve mattress quality include their ability to promote airflow and temperature regulation. For instance, the porous structure of natural latex allows for air circulation, reducing heat retention. Likewise, organic cotton absorbs and releases moisture effectively, creating a dry sleeping surface.
Specific conditions that highlight the benefits of organic materials involve those with allergies or sensitivities. For example, individuals sensitive to chemical off-gassing from synthetic mattresses may experience less discomfort when using organic alternatives. Moreover, mattresses made from organic materials often have certifications ensuring they meet strict health and environmental standards.
